Fig. 1 Chromatograms of Squama Manis under different (a) extraction solvent, (b) extraction mode, and (c) extraction time Column: Symmetry 300 C18 (150 mm×4.6 mm, 5 μm). Mobile phase A: 0.1% (v/v) trifluoroacetic acid (TFA) in water, mobile phase B: 0.1% (v/v) TFA in acetonitrile. Gradient elution: 0-40 min, 0-50%B; 40-60 min, 50%B-95%B.
Fig. 2 Chromatograms of Squama Manis on different columns Mobile phase A: 0.1% (v/v) TFA in water; mobile phase B: 0.1% (v/v) TFA in acetonitrile. Gradient condition: 0-40 min, 0-50%B; 40-60 min, 50%B-95%B.
Fig. 3 Chromatograms of Squama Manis under different gradient conditions Column: Symmetry 300 C18. Mobile phase A: 0.1% (v/v) TFA in water, mobile phase B: 0.1% (v/v) TFA in acetonitrile. a. 0-40 min, 0-50%B; 40-60 min, 50%B-95%B. b. 0-50 min, 0-40%B; 50-51 min, 40%B-90%B; 51-60 min, 90%B. c. 0-50 min, 0-30%B; 50-51 min, 30%B-90%B; 51-60 min, 90%B.
